How do physical activities during childhood affect future health? 🔊
Physical activities during childhood significantly affect future health by establishing foundational habits. Early engagement in sports or play enhances motor skills, coordination, and social interaction, fostering a love for movement. Children who are active tend to maintain healthier weight levels and are less prone to obesity and related diseases in later life. Additionally, regular physical activity promotes positive mental health outcomes, reducing the risk of anxiety and depression. Overall, encouraging active lifestyles during childhood lays the groundwork for lifelong health and well-being.
